  • Understanding Alamodome Capacity Basics

    Let's break down the basics first. The Alamodome capacity can vary wildly depending on the type of event. For football games, it can hold around 65,000 to 70,000 fans, which is pretty insane if you ask me. But here's the kicker – for concerts or other non-sporting events, the number drops significantly, sometimes down to 18,000. Why? Because the setup changes completely.

    Alamodome Capacity for Football Games

    When it comes to football, the Alamodome really shines. With a capacity of around 65,000 to 70,000, it's one of the largest indoor stadiums in the country. But here's the interesting part – the seating isn't just about quantity; it's about quality too. The design ensures that every fan has a great view of the action, no matter where they're sitting. And if you're lucky enough to snag a seat in the lower bowl, you're in for a treat.

    For college football games, the atmosphere is electric. The Alamodome has hosted the Alamo Bowl for years, drawing in fans from all over the country. And let's not forget the high school football championships, where the energy is off the charts. It's not just about the numbers; it's about the experience.

    Concerts and Special Events

    Switching gears to concerts and special events, the Alamodome capacity drops significantly. For a typical concert setup, you're looking at around 18,000 to 25,000 fans. But don't let that fool you – the intimacy of the venue makes it one of the best places to catch a live show. The sound system is top-notch, and the stage setup is designed to give every fan an unforgettable experience.

    Alamodome History and Renovations

    Let's take a quick trip down memory lane. The Alamodome opened its doors in 1993, and since then, it's been a staple in San Antonio's entertainment scene. Over the years, it's undergone several renovations to keep up with the times. The latest renovations focused on improving the seating arrangements and upgrading the technology to enhance the overall fan experience.

    One of the most significant changes was the addition of more VIP sections and premium seating options. This move was a response to the growing demand for luxury experiences at sporting events and concerts. And let's not forget the upgrades to the sound and lighting systems, which have taken the concert experience to the next level.

    Tickets and Pricing

    Tickets for Alamodome events can vary widely in price, depending on the event and the seating section. For football games, you're looking at anywhere from $20 to $200, depending on how close you want to be to the action. Concerts, on the other hand, can range from $30 to $150, with VIP packages going even higher.
